Heather, Hi, i'm Amanda and im 17 years old. I was diagnosed with Endo 2 years ago. My ob/gyn put me on seasonale and it didnt work on me either. I have also been on depot-provera, it stopped my periods but I was still bleeding internally. After my 3rd shot of depot-provera, I went to see an Endo specialist (Dr. Jaffe in Orlando) and she put me on Lupron, I only had 3 shots of Lupron before I stopped taking it because it made me incredibly sick. I have had 2 laps and having my 3rd one tomorrow. Have you tried surgery? I dont know if you have heard of Dr. Redwine, I have heard alot of good things about him. If you send your whole medical file to him in Oregon, he will analyze it and give his opinion, however, it is $150. Thats just a suggestion. Im sorry that I dont have any more advice for you but maybe seeing a Endo specialist is the best thing to do. If you have any advice for me, I would really appreciate it. I hope everything goes well.
